Dell and HP happy about Microsoft acquisition of Virtual PC

Two choice “Supporting Industry Quotes” from Microsoft’s press release announcing the acquisition of Connectix Virtual Machine Technology:

“We fully support Microsoft’s efforts to drive a standards-based approach to virtualization, and together will collaborate on integrated hardware and software solutions that help enterprises consolidate network resources, improve control and optimize IT investments. Companies worldwide are feeling the pressure of smaller IT budgets and increasingly rely on standards-based solutions from trusted partners to help lower costs and improve IT infrastructure.”
– Linda Hargrove
Vice President, Worldwide Enterprise Systems Marketing and Product Management
Dell Computer Corp.

“HP is very excited about Microsoft’s acquisition of Connectix. Many of our Windows Server customers require virtual partitioning. Connectix’s Virtual Server technologies running on HP’s industry-leading ProLiant servers will be a great solution for our customers.”
– Rick Becker
Vice President and Software CTO
HP Industry Standard Servers
